FINANCIALS: Robert Half growth through tech and Protiviti

Professional recruiter Robert Half in Q1 saw marginal revenue growth thanks to increased revenues in its technology division and its consulting firm Protiviti, as well as improved net income.

Net income was $55.9m (£36.6m), up from $48.3m in the same quarter in 2012, while revenues at $1.023bn increased from the previous period’s $1.015bn.

A slight drop in revenues at accountancy brand Accountemps and Robert Half Management Resources were accompanied by marginal growth at OfficeTeam and Robert Half Finance & Accounting, while Robert Half Technology grew 5% and Protiviti by 14%.
